C# 多线程无参/带参执行方法

private void button1_Click(object sender, EventArgs e)
{
	//无参方式一
	Thread thread = new Thread(display);
	thread.Start();
	
	//无参方式二
	Thread thread = new Thread(new ThreadStart(display));
	thread.Start();
	
	//带参方式一
	Thread thread = new Thread(display);
	thread.Start("Name");
	
	//带参方式二
	Thread thread = new Thread(new ThreadStart(delegate () { display("Name", age); }));
	thread.Start();
}

public void display()
{
	//这里是执行的代码
}

public void display(object Name)
{
	//这里是执行的代码
}

public void display(string Name,int age)
{
	//这里是执行的代码
}

 

原文地址:https://fendou.gqr5.cn/7721.html
------本页内容已结束,喜欢请分享------

感谢您的来访,获取更多精彩文章请收藏本站。

THE END
喜欢就打个赏呗
点赞0赞赏 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容